Staff and faculty can now register for the One Campus Summit

Departments with the Finance and Operations division are excited to host the One Campus Summit 2026, a free, in-person, three-day learning and collaboration conference for all staff and faculty. The summit will take place 8:30 a.m. to 4 p.m., Jan. 27-29, 2026, in the Student Union Building's Jordan ballroom.

Designed to strengthen campuswide partnerships and knowledge sharing, the summit features keynote speakers, hands-on workshops and breakout sessions hosted by Campus Operations, Compliance, Human Resources, the Office of Information Technology, the Department of Public Safety, University Financial Services, and University Policy.

Topics will span AI basics, campus safety, the campus master plan, HR processes and programs, travel and reimbursement procedures, compliance and policy, professional development and more - offering something for every role and department.

Dining options

This conference is being provided for free to attendees. Lunch will not be provided, but water, coffee and light grab and go snacks will be available. Attendees are encouraged to bring a lunch, or enjoy a lunch at one of the many dining locations in the Student Union. Conference rooms will remain open for eating and networking during the lunch hour.
